In a helpful and willing way; showing readiness to do favors or assist.
الاستخدام والفروق الدقيقة
Used mainly in formal or written English. Describes actions done kindly and with a natural willingness to help. Often appears with verbs of action ("smiled obligingly", "helped obligingly"). Less common in everyday conversation; "helpfully" or "willingly" are more usual in speech.
